Also, something I didn't know, the trust fund running out doesn't mean benefits cease. It just means benefits would only be funded at 70-75% of what they were. this article is from April 28, 1998 and also predicted 2032 as the year the trust fund would run out. [https://www.cbpp.org/sites/default/files/archive/424socsec.htm](https://www.cbpp.org/sites/default/files/archive/424socsec.htm) "Social Security will not be bankrupt when the trust fund surplus is exhausted after 2032. The trust funds will continue after that year to receive large sums from payroll tax collections. The problem is that after 2032, according to the trustees' calculations, the incoming taxes will be sufficient to cover about 70 percent to 75 percent of the benefit payments rather than 100 percent of these costs"
